    HR Manager

    Job Description

    Our client is a globally recognized company in the Agricultural industry. They seek to hire an experienced HR Manager whowill be accountable for the Human Resources function for operations in Kenya.

    • Partnering with the business providing both strategic and tactical support to our three business areas tea, grains & grain silo storage to achieve its goals and new business growth opportunities. Working alongside the shared services teams in Europe.
    • Accountable for the Human Resources function for operations in Kenya.
    • Partner with the business providing both strategic and tactical support to the three business areas tea, grains & grain silo storage to achieve its goals and new business growth opportunities.
    • Work alongside our shared services teams in Europe.
    • Partner with business and support for business growth providing HR solutions with tactical action plans having oversight of three locations.
    • Collaborate with Europe HR function leads to support talent management, development and retention, working closely with local management
    • Coach local HR team with a view of developing and raising the bar on performance.
    • Deliver HR policies and practices that are compliant with Cargill corporate guidelines, country labour and Manpower Regulations, Social Framework and EHS rules.
    • Ensure you provide industry related – market competitive compensation and benefit programs, through external benchmarking
    • Manage industrial /labour relations, assisting with union negotiations, compliance & relationship essential; handle labour disputes; handle disciplinary issues; Labour injury claims. Work permits.
    • Lead employee engagement & change initiatives

    Qualifications

    • Bachelor’s degree in either Human Resources, Social Sciences, Arts or Business
    • 8 years + in Human Resources
    • Must have a current practicing certificate with IHRM
    • HR management level, participating in HR strategy and in complex business environments
    • Experience working in a multi-national
    • Payroll experience desired to manage the process
    • Experience of difficult blue collar labour intensive environments
    • Active participation in trade union & bargaining council negotiations
    • Managing change.
    • Experience in the Commodity Trading, Silo or Shipping and Tea warehousing industry desirable
    • Ability to operate at both strategic and tactical levels
    • Ability to deal with ambiguity
    • Ability and confidence to engage and influence at senior levels
    • Fluent in English due to the nature of the international organization, a good command of Kiswahili language is desired,
    • Strong Analytical Skills
    •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
    • Data Privacy management
